The Role - Nurture Teacher (1:1)

Through our Nurture Pathway, you will work 1:1 with pupils across Oxfordshire who are currently out of school due to:

• Special Educational Needs and Disabilities (SEND)
• Social, Emotional and Mental Health needs (SEMH)
• Emotionally Based School Avoidance (EBSA)
• Risk of exclusion or permanent exclusion
• Anxiety, trauma or disengagement from education

You will design and deliver bespoke, interest-led learning sessions tailored to each young person.

This is relationship-first teaching.

Your work will focus on rebuilding confidence, re-engaging learners and supporting successful reintegration into education — at a pace that works for them.
